アーベ(AAVE)のプライバシー保護機能はどうなっている?
アーベ(AAVE:Account Abstraction via Validium)は、イーサリアムのスケーラビリティ問題を解決し、より安全で使いやすいWeb3体験を提供する目的で開発されたレイヤー2ソリューションです。その核心的な機能の一つが、高度なプライバシー保護機能です。本稿では、アーベが提供するプライバシー保護機能について、技術的な詳細、実装方法、そして将来的な展望を含めて詳細に解説します。
1. アーベのプライバシー保護の基本思想
アーベのプライバシー保護は、単に取引の匿名性を高めるだけでなく、ユーザーのデジタルアイデンティティを保護し、データ漏洩のリスクを最小限に抑えることを目的としています。従来のブロックチェーン技術では、取引履歴が公開台帳に記録されるため、ユーザーの行動が追跡される可能性があります。アーベは、Validiumという技術を採用することで、取引データをオフチェーンに保存し、必要な場合にのみオンチェーンで検証を行うことで、この問題を解決します。
アーベのプライバシー保護の基本思想は以下の3点に集約されます。
- データの最小化: 必要なデータのみを収集し、不要な情報は保存しない。
- データの暗号化: 収集したデータを暗号化し、不正アクセスから保護する。
- ゼロ知識証明: データの内容を明らかにすることなく、その正当性を証明する。
2. Validiumによるプライバシー保護
アーベの中核技術であるValidiumは、オフチェーンでのデータ処理とオンチェーンでのデータ検証を組み合わせることで、スケーラビリティとプライバシー保護を両立します。Validiumでは、取引データはオフチェーンのValidiumチェーンに保存され、Validiumチェーンのオペレーターがデータの整合性を保証します。オンチェーンでは、Validiumチェーンの状態を証明するValidium Proofのみが記録されるため、取引データそのものは公開されません。
Validiumのプライバシー保護機能は、以下の要素によって強化されています。
- z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ge): zk-SNARKsは、データの内容を明らかにすることなく、その正当性を証明する暗号技術です。アーベでは、zk-SNARKsを用いて、Validiumチェーンの状態が正しいことを証明し、オンチェーンでの検証を効率化しています。
- データ可用性サンプリング: Validiumチェーンのデータ可用性を確保するために、データ可用性サンプリングという技術が用いられます。データ可用性サンプリングは、Validiumチェーンのデータをランダムにサンプリングし、その結果をオンチェーンで検証することで、データが利用可能であることを保証します。
- 不正証明システム: Validiumチェーンのオペレーターが不正行為を行った場合、ユーザーは不正証明を提出することで、その不正行為を証明し、補償を受けることができます。
3. アーベにおけるプライバシー保護の実装
アーベでは、Validiumの技術を基盤として、さらに高度なプライバシー保護機能を実装しています。具体的には、以下の機能が提供されています。
3.1. プライベートトランザクション
アーベでは、ユーザーがプライベートトランザクションを送信することができます。プライベートトランザクションは、取引の送信者、受信者、および取引額が暗号化されるため、第三者は取引の内容を知ることができません。プライベートトランザクションは、zk-SNARKsを用いて実装されており、高いセキュリティと効率性を実現しています。
3.2. シークレットアカウント
アーベでは、ユーザーがシークレットアカウントを作成することができます。シークレットアカウントは、通常のイーサリアムアカウントとは異なり、アカウントの所有者を特定することが困難です。シークレットアカウントは、zk-SNARKsを用いて実装されており、高い匿名性を実現しています。
3.3. プライバシー保護型スマートコントラクト
アーベでは、プライバシー保護型スマートコントラクトを開発することができます。プライバシー保護型スマートコントラクトは、スマートコントラクトの実行時に、データのプライバシーを保護することができます。プライバシー保護型スマートコントラクトは、zk-SNARKsやその他の暗号技術を用いて実装されており、高いセキュリティとプライバシー保護を実現しています。
3.4. 混合サービス
アーベは、複数のトランザクションを混合することで、取引の追跡を困難にする混合サービスを提供します。このサービスは、ユーザーのプライバシーをさらに強化し、取引の匿名性を高めます。
4. アーベのプライバシー保護と規制
アーベのプライバシー保護機能は、規制当局の監視の対象となる可能性があります。特に、マネーロンダリング防止(AML)やテロ資金供与対策(CFT)の観点から、プライバシー保護機能が不正行為に利用されるリスクが懸念されています。アーベの開発チームは、規制当局との連携を強化し、プライバシー保護機能が規制に準拠するように努めています。
具体的には、以下の対策が講じられています。
- KYC/AMLコンプライアンス: アーベは、KYC(Know Your Customer)/AML(Anti-Money Laundering)コンプライアンスを遵守し、ユーザーの身元確認と取引の監視を行っています。
- トランザクションモニタリング: アーベは、トランザクションモニタリングシステムを導入し、不正な取引を検知しています。
- 規制当局との協力: アーベは、規制当局との情報共有や協力体制を構築し、規制に準拠したサービスを提供しています。
5. アーベのプライバシー保護の将来展望
アーベのプライバシー保護機能は、今後さらに進化していくことが予想されます。具体的には、以下の技術の開発が進められています。
- Multi-Party Computation (MPC): MPCは、複数の当事者が共同で計算を行うことで、個々の当事者のデータを明らかにすることなく、計算結果を得る暗号技術です。アーベでは、MPCを用いて、プライバシー保護型スマートコントラクトの機能を強化し、より複雑な計算を可能にすることを目指しています。
- Fully Homomorphic Encryption (FHE): FHEは、暗号化されたデータのまま計算を行うことができる暗号技術です。アーベでは、FHEを用いて、プライバシー保護型スマートコントラクトのセキュリティをさらに高め、データの漏洩リスクを最小限に抑えることを目指しています。
- Differential Privacy: Differential Privacyは、データセットにノイズを加えることで、個々のデータのプライバシーを保護する技術です。アーベでは、Differential Privacyを用いて、データ分析の際に、ユーザーのプライバシーを保護することを目指しています。
これらの技術の開発により、アーベは、より高度なプライバシー保護機能を提供し、Web3の普及を加速させることが期待されます。
まとめ
アーベは、Validiumという革新的な技術を採用することで、イーサリアムのスケーラビリティ問題を解決し、同時に高度なプライバシー保護機能を提供します。プライベートトランザクション、シークレットアカウント、プライバシー保護型スマートコントラクトなどの機能により、ユーザーのデジタルアイデンティティを保護し、データ漏洩のリスクを最小限に抑えることができます。規制当局との連携を強化し、プライバシー保護機能が規制に準拠するように努めながら、MPC、FHE、Differential Privacyなどの技術開発を進めることで、アーベは、Web3のプライバシー保護におけるリーダーとしての地位を確立していくでしょう。